| history | Top Speed (c) 1987 Taito. A driving game very similar to "Out Run", except for the addition of the nitro boost button. The car featured is a red Mazda RX-7. - TECHNICAL - Board Number : K1100273A Prom Sticker : B14 Main CPU : (2x) 68000 (@ 12 Mhz) Sound CPU : Z80 (@ 4 Mhz) Sound Chips : YM2151 (@ 4 Mhz), MSM5205 (@ 384 Khz) Screen orientation : Horizontal Video resolution : 320 x 240 pixels Screen refresh : 60.00 Hz Palette colors : 8192 Players : 1 Control : Steering wheel Buttons : 8 - TRIVIA - Released in October 1987. Licensed to Romstar for US manufacture and distribution. This game is known in Japan as "Full Throttle". Top Speed is Taito's response to Sega's "Out Run". This game was the forerunner of the Taito Z system on which Taito's driving games were based from 1988-91 (You can spot some similarities with "Continental Circus", the first of the Taito Z games). Pony Canyon / Scitron released a limited-edition soundtrack album for this game (The Ninja Warriors : G.S.M. Taito 1 - D28B0001) on 21/06/1988.
